The refers to the digital verification process used by citizens, law enforcement agencies, and auto insurance companies to cross-verify the legal and theft status of motor vehicles in India . Developed by the National Crime Records Bureau (NCRB) in coordination with the Ministry of Road Transport and Highways (MoRTH), this database system serves as a central repository to track stolen and recovered automobiles nationwide. Historically, tracking stolen vehicles across state lines was a bureaucratic nightmare due to fragmented regional servers. To resolve this, MoRTH deployed VAHAN 4.0 , a centralized portal managed by the , ensuring all local RTO data flows consistently into a single National Register e-Services database.
